End-to-End Vessel Solutions
Whether on a spot or time charter basis, we ensure vessel availability, regulatory compliance, and seamless operations — from loading to discharge.
We charter and coordinate a wide range of vessel types tailored to cargo size, product type, and delivery route:
- Crude Oil Tankers (VLCC, Suezmax, Aframax)
- Product Tankers (MR, LR1, LR2)
- LPG Vessels (VLGC, pressurized, semi-refrigerated)
- Dry Bulk Vessels for Agro Commodities (Handysize, Supramax, Panamax)
